The Graduate Certificate in Petroleum Engineering Supervision is a specialized program designed for individuals seeking to enhance their skills in supervising petroleum engineering projects.
This program focuses on providing students with the knowledge and expertise required to effectively manage and supervise petroleum engineering projects, ensuring they are completed on time, within budget, and to the required quality standards.
Learning outcomes of the Graduate Certificate in Petroleum Engineering Supervision include the ability to apply project management principles and techniques, lead and manage cross-functional teams, and make informed decisions that balance technical, commercial, and environmental considerations.
The duration of the Graduate Certificate in Petroleum Engineering Supervision is typically one year full-time, although part-time options are also available.
The program is designed to be completed in a relatively short period, allowing students to quickly gain the skills and knowledge required to succeed in this field.
